1. The Role of Kelim and Or
- The act of Tzimtzum and concealment is represented by the concept of kelim (vessels), which obscure the Divine life-force (or, meaning “light”).
- The kelim ensure that created beings cannot perceive the G-dliness inherent within them.
2. Letters and Divine Utterances
- Kelim are associated with the letters of the ten Divine utterances, which form the life-force of created beings.
- These letters are rooted in the five special Hebrew letters מנצפ”ך (mem, nun, tzadi, peh, kaf), which signify five levels of gevurah (restraint).
3. Source of Gevurah and Chesed
- The source of the five levels of gevurah is termed Butzina deKardunita, signifying a “light from darkness,” a level of concealment that transcends light itself.
- This gevurah originates from Atik Yomin, a spiritual level of keter (crown) that surpasses all worlds, including Atzilut.
- Parallel to this, the source of Divine kindness is chesed of Atik Yomin, emphasizing balance within creation.
